This is a great course. I had heard people referring to it as 'Australia's Augusta'. This set expectations and I must say the course certainly met them. Immaculate maintenance / conditions and a challenging and fun lay-out. Compared to other courses in the area, it is a fairly punchy investment to play here but I think it is worth it.
Holes 7 and 11 are certainly memorable, but they are all great.
The club does not allow people to walk the course so buggies are mandatory. This seemed strange at first but the terrain is so huge that it certainly makes sense.
As the single downside I note that the staff / marshall have their own ideas on etiquette and particularly pace of play.
Food in the restaurant is amazing and reasonably priced. Hotel rooms are mediocre, but located immediately next to the first fairway and the driving range so that is very convenient.

Bonville is a beautiful resort course 6-6.5 hours drive north of Sydney. A stunning area in Coffs Harbour with lots of things to do for the whole family.
The golf course is impressive with its layout in the middle of all the natural vegetation growing. There is a lot of wildlife living on the course including kangaroos, birds, lizards and even koalas!
A definite cart/electric buggy course due to the long walks between holes!
The guys in the pro shop are very friendly and have great gear in the shop so make sure you check it out!

Bonville Golf Resort is very pretty, with lots of nature surrounding the course. When I was there we were lucky and spotted a few Koalas in the trees, but also some reptiles! It's a tree lined course with a lot of slopes. This isn't a problem though, as you have to use a cart. Solid golf course, definitely looking forward to playing here again!
